Freezing mushrooms

Frozen mushrooms can be stored safely throughout the year without losing their nutritional value. It is best to harvest mushroom caps in this way, but it is recommended to remove the legs.

It should be remembered that not all types of mushrooms tolerate freezing equally well. For her, for example, aspen and boletus mushrooms, mushrooms (both fresh and boiled) and boletus are suitable. Other types of mushrooms must be boiled before freezing. Otherwise, they acquire an unpleasant bitter taste.
